Veronica Lake was prominent in films during the 1940s and became a fav for Diane Haughton (Aaliyah’s mother) growing up.
In the mid 90’s as Aaliyah was reinventing her signature style in music and fashion for her sophomore album, Diane suggested that Aaliyah style her hair like Miss Lake because the hair over the eye gave off a sense of mystique and sex appeal.
Aaliyah would then adopt this style as her own signature look. It’s said that even when Aaliyah checked into hotels, she’d use the name “Veronica Lake”.
Veronica Lake passed away in 1973 at the age of 51.

Born in Brooklyn and raised in Detroit
Aaliyah Dana Haughton was born on January 16, 1979, in Brooklyn, New York City, New York, the younger child of Diane and Michael "Miguel" Haughton, a warehouse worker. She was of African-American descent. Her name is the feminine form of the Arabic "Ali", meaning "highest, most exalted one, the best." Aaliyah was fond of her name, calling it "beautiful" and saying she was "very proud of it" and strove to live up to her name every day.
She first gained recognition at the age of 10, when she appeared on the television show Star Search and performed in concert alongside Gladys Knight. At the age of 12, She signed with Jive Records and her uncle Barry Hankerson's Blackground Records. Hankerson introduced her to R. Kelly, who became her mentor, as well as lead songwriter and producer of her debut album, Age Ain't Nothing but a Number (1994). The album sold three million copies in the United States and was certified double platinum by the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A). After allegations of an illegal marriage with Kelly, She ended her contract with Jive and signed with Atlantic Records.
She was an American singer and actress. She has been credited with helping to redefine contemporary R&B, pop, and hip hop, earning her the nicknames the "Princess of R&B" and "Queen of Urban Pop".
She worked with record producers Timbaland and Missy Elliott for her second album, One in a Million (1996), which sold three million copies in the United States and more than eight million copies worldwide. In 2000, She made her acting debut in the film Romeo Must Die. She contributed to the film's soundtrack, which was supported by her single "Try Again". The song topped the Billboard Hot 100 solely through airplay, becoming the first in the chart's history to do so. After completing the film, She subsequently filmed her starring role in Queen of the Damned (which was released posthumously), and in July 2001, released her eponymous third album, which topped the Billboard 200. The album spawned the singles "Rock the Boat", "More Than Woman", and "We Need a Resolution" (featuring Timbaland).
On August 25, 2001, at the age of 22, She was killed in an airplane accident in the Bahamas along with eight other people on board, when the overloaded aircraft she was traveling in crashed shortly after takeoff. The pilot was later found to have traces of cocaine and alcohol in his body and was not qualified to fly the aircraft designated for the flight. Her family filed a wrongful death lawsuit against the aircraft's operator, which was settled out of court. In the decades following her death, Her music has continued to achieve commercial success, aided by several posthumous releases. She has sold 8.1 million albums in the US and an estimated 24 to 32 million albums worldwide. Billboard lists her as the tenth most successful female R&B artist of the past 25 years, and the 27th most successful in history. Her accolades include three American Music Awards and two MTV VMAs, along with five Grammy Award nominations.

#OnThisDay DKNY presents the Vanity Fair "In Concert" series a tribute to Aaliyah in New York on October 22, 2002
Diane Haughton and Damon Dash were seen attending.
Vanessa Carlton, Missy Elliott, Cheryl "Pepsi" Riley, Howie Day, and Tweet were also performers at this event.
